The average resident of Kendall earns $34,378 per year, just under the national average. This number has been increasing at a rate of 8.9% a year, which is 19% higher than the national average growth rate. Kendall is an educated town: 88% have earned at least a high school diploma, while 40% have a bachelor's degree or higher.
With Miami less than 15 miles away, there are plenty of job opportunities available. PRC, a communications company, has been within the Miami-Dade County for over ten years, and has been hiring several hundred people since its opening in Kendall last year. Other major employers include:
- Miami University
- Miami Airport
Best of all, Kendall can be found right on the edge of the beautiful Florida Everglades. With Miami Beach and Fort Lauderdale both nearby, there are plenty of attractions. For those who love the outdoors, there's warm weather all year round, not to mention the numerous parks and gardens within this county to explore.
